Output f28408a63063ee443217a966236fbd48fd0f4b13a8af30c31f91231a8a01dac0:0

value
2036061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 730f6741733815f09bda30042286d8bd742402db OP_EQUAL
address
3CBQ5r6PnEsgNntSUCFtDUfgo7C5VCZRtS
transaction
f28408a63063ee443217a966236fbd48fd0f4b13a8af30c31f91231a8a01dac0
confirmations
188336
spent
true